Voir les tableaux de bord Emoncms & ESP8266 + Arduino #IoT : 7 étapes (avec photos)
Voir les tableaux de bord Emoncms & ESP8266 + Arduino #IoT : 7 étapes (avec photos)

Vidéo: Voir les tableaux de bord Emoncms & ESP8266 + Arduino #IoT : 7 étapes (avec photos)

Vidéo: Voir les tableaux de bord Emoncms & ESP8266 + Arduino #IoT : 7 étapes (avec photos)
Vidéo: Review PZEM-004T with Arduino ESP32 ESP8266 Python & Raspberry Pi : PDAControl 2025, Janvier
Anonim

Depuis longtemps j'ai testé la plateforme Emoncms et à cette occasion je vais vous montrer le résultat final et la qualité des tableaux de bord et/ou visualisations.

J'ai suivi quelques tutoriels qui serviront d'étapes intermédiaires.

Nous visualiserons un tableau de bord créé dans emoncms, à partir de plusieurs appareils, le temps de mise à jour et le dynamisme des widgets et des graphiques.

Dans ce tutoriel, nous ne détaillerons pas le matériel même si, bien qu'il s'agisse de données réelles, le matériel final est toujours en développement.

Techniquement il y a 3 appareils:

1- Arduino Mega 2560 + ESP8266 01 (MONITEUR SOLAIRE)

- 2 mesures de température (Onewire)

- 2 Mesures de tensions continues (conditionnement)

- 1 mesure d'intensité lumineuse (LDR)

2- Circuit de charge très simple LM317, pour

-1 Batterie acide 6v 1.2Ah

-1 panneau solaire 10W

3- Esp8266 12E NodeMCU Lolin (STATION SOLAIRE)

-1 DHT 11 Température et humidité relative

L'idée 1 analyser le comportement du panneau solaire.

L'idée 2 jusqu'à présent est d'alimenter l'ESP8266 12E 24h/24 et 7j/7 consommant 80mA sans mode veille.

InformationDocumentation en anglais disponible sur

Documentación Español disponible en

Plus Tester Youtube

Canal PDAControl

Étape 1: Tableaux de bord en temps réel

Tableaux de bord en temps réel

Malheureusement je ne peux pas intégrer les graphiques sur ce site..:(Mais à partir de ce lien, vous pouvez voir les tableaux de bord en temps réel !!!

Pero desde este enlace pueden ver el Dashboards en Tiempo Real!!!!

Étape 2: vues

  • Voir Moniteur PC 1280x720 Chrome (Google Chrome) Lubuntu
  • Voir Moniteur PC 1280x720 Firefox Lubuntu
  • Voir Tablette 7" Samsung (Android)
  • Voir téléphone 4" Samsung (Android)

Étape 3: Emoncms (OpenEnergyMonitor)

Bien que nous mettrons l'accent sur la plate-forme, il est important de connaître la mission principale du projet OpenEnergyMonitor. est un outil pour aider et conserver l'utilisation de l'énergie

(thermique, solaire, éolien…) et de collaborer au développement durable. étape est de mesurer, d'analyser et de prendre des mesures ….. bien c'est mon humble avis.

Il existe 3 versions de modes d'Emoncms

  • Installation locale sur PC
  • Compte sur Emoncms.org
  • Installation dans l'hébergement

Comme j'ai acheté un hébergement avec Arvixe, j'ai décidé de monter en hébergement.

Doumentation

Installation de la plate-forme IoT Emoncms dans lubuntu Linux

Site Web: OpenEnergyMonitor - Emoncms

Étape 4: Introduction WifiManager + ESP8266

J'ai implémenté la bibliothèque WifiManager pour faciliter la configuration des identifiants réseau et le paramétrage en général des modules ESP8266.

Documentation complète

Introduction à la bibliothèque WifiManager esp8266 expliquée - expliqué: PDAControl

Étape 5: WifiManager + Premiers tests Emoncms + ESP8266

Dans la première implémentation de WifiManager avec Emoncms, il permet la configuration d'une grande partie des paramètres requis par la Plateforme WEB.

Cet exemple initial effectue une lecture de la température et envoie des données à l'aide d'un client

Documentation complète: WifiManager + Emoncms (OEM) avec ESP8266 (température) #1

Étape 6: Première intégration WiFiManager + Client Emoncms sur ESP8266

Première intégration WiFiManager + client Emoncms sur ESP8266, Test de connexion avec les 3 variantes de la plateforme Emoncms, configuration des nœuds depuis WifiManager

Étape 7: Conclusions et plus d'informations

Conclusion

Visualisant le tableau de bord à partir de différents navigateurs, différents systèmes d'exploitation et surtout à différentes résolutions, la visualisation est toujours parfaite, de mon point de vue.

Recommandation: Dans le cas des navigateurs sous Android, activez l'option "voir comme un ordinateur"

Dans les prochains tutos je détaillerai en détail le matériel mis en oeuvre, je répète c'est un premier test j'espère qu'il vous plaira.

Mesure de Tension dans des batteries, Panneaux Solaires D'abord avec Arduino… puis avec ESP8266.

Tableaux de bord en temps réel

Mais à partir de ce lien, vous pouvez voir les tableaux de bord en temps réel !!!

Pero desde este enlace pueden ver elDashboards en Tiempo Real!!!!

Informations

Documentation disponible sur

Documentation disponible sur

Plus Tester Youtube

Canal PDAControl